Overview ES-Que 50mg Tablet SR
Quetiapine 50mg extended-release tablets treat schizophrenia (a severe mental illness causing hallucinations, delusions, and impaired thinking/behavior) and manic episodes. It's also used for bipolar disorder. Quetiapine 50mg ER tablets can be taken with or without food, but consistent daily timing ensures stable blood levels. Follow your doctor's prescribed dosage and duration; if a dose is missed, take it immediately upon remembering. Never abruptly stop treatment without consulting your physician, as this could exacerbate symptoms. Discontinue immediately if Neuroleptic Malignant Syndrome (NMS) occurs (fever, muscle stiffness, altered mental state, or seizures). Common side effects include reduced hemoglobin, elevated triglycerides, decreased cholesterol, headache, extrapyramidal symptoms, dry mouth, and withdrawal symptoms. Initially, postural hypotension (sudden blood pressure drops upon standing) may occur; rise slowly from sitting or lying. Dizziness and drowsiness are also possible; avoid driving or tasks requiring alertness until the drug's effects are known. Weight gain is a potential side effect; a healthy diet and exercise can mitigate this. Increased diabetes risk exists; regular glucose monitoring is advised. Report any unusual mood shifts, new or worsening depression, or suicidal thoughts to your doctor promptly.

How to use ES-Que 50mg Tablet SR:
Consume this medication precisely as prescribed by your physician, adhering to the specified dosage and treatment length. Ingest the tablet whole; avoid chewing, crushing, or fracturing it. ES-Que 50mg Extended-Release Tablets can be administered with or without food, although consistent timing is recommended.
How ES-Que 50mg Tablet SR works:
Quetiapine fumarate 50mg extended-release tablets are an atypical antipsychotic medication. Their mechanism of action involves regulating neurotransmitters in the brain responsible for cognitive function.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Concurrent alcohol consumption and ES-Que 50mg Tablet SR is inadvisable.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Prolonged-release ES-Que 50mg tablets might pose risks during pregnancy. While human data is scarce, animal research indicates pot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the potential advantages against any possible dangers prior to prescribing this medication. Seek medical advice.
Breast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Extended-release Quetiapine 50mg tablets may pose a risk to breastfeeding infants. Available human data indicates potential transfer to breast milk and consequent infant harm.
DrivingUNSAFE
Extended-release Quetiapine 50mg tablets can reduce vigilance, impair vision, and induce drowsiness or dizziness. Driving is prohibited if these effects manifest.
KidneyS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The extended-release 50mg ES-Que tablet is likely safe for individuals with impaired kidney function. Preliminary findings indicate dose modification may be unnecessary; however, physician consultation is recommended.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with liver impairment should exercise caution when using ES-Que 50mg sustained-release tablets. Dosage modification of ES-Que 50mg sustained-release tablets may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.
What if you forget to take ES-Que 50mg Tablet SR :
Should you forget to take your ES-Que 50mg Tablet SR, administer it immediately upon remembrance.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osage routine. Avoid taking a double dose.
